WebTPA, a GuideWell Company, is a healthcare third‑party benefit administrator with over 30 years of experience building unique benefit solutions and managing customized health plans.
Job Description As a Customer Service Representative , you will be responsible for handling inbound customer calls from both providers and members. You will work diligently to ensure the highest level of service is provided in a courteous manner, no matter what the question or concern.
Key Position Details
Location: 19100 Ridgewood Pkwy, San Antonio, TX 78259 (in office)
Compensation: $18.00 per hour + Quarterly Bonus!
Full‑time position
Comprehensive Benefits
Training Hours: Monday to Friday, 8:00 am to 4:30 pm CST
Work availability required: Monday to Friday with 8‑hour shift between the hours of 7:00 am and 7:00 pm CST
What You Will Be Doing
Successfully complete a 4+ week training program.
Answer inbound calls from providers and members.
Provide resolution for questions about benefits, claims and eligibility.
Document notes of each call to ensure all information is saved.
Ensure adherence to Customer Service metrics, including:
Average monthly After Call Work (AUX) time
Average monthly hold time
Average monthly staff time
Average monthly talk time
Average monthly quality
Handle call backs and escalations as necessary.
Qualifications
0–1 years related work experience.
Inbound call center experience in the health insurance industry.
High school diploma or GED.
Professional phone voice and etiquette.
Demonstrated proficiency in Microsoft Word, Excel and Outlook.
Excellent verbal and written communication skills required.
